Welcome back to the Law School Toolbox podcast! Today we are excited to welcome Rebecca Petrilli – Midwest Attorney Director at Themis Bar Review – back to the podcast to discuss IRAC and best practices for legal writing on exams, including the bar exam.

In this episode we discuss:
- Understanding the IRAC structure
- Law school exam grading scale
- Is a longer essay always better?
- Handling unknown law on an exam
